The Peninsula Gateway is a newspaper based out of Gig Harbor, Washington, founded in 1917. [2] [3] The newspaper covers the local news of Gig Harbor and Key Peninsula. [4] [5] The Peninsula Gateway is published once a week on Wednesdays. [3] Its online content can be found via the websites News Tribune and the Seattle Times.
